Overview
The MAX11137ATI+T, produced by Analog Devices Inc./Maxim Integrated, is a high-performance, low-power, 16-channel analog-to-digital converter (ADC) designed for multichannel applications. This device features a successive approximation register (SAR) architecture and operates at a sampling rate of 500 kS/s. It is particularly suited for applications requiring high accuracy, flexibility, and low power consumption.
Key Specifications
Parameter | Value | Units |
---|---|---|
Number of Channels | 16 | |
Resolution | 12-bit | |
Sampling Rate | 500 kS/s | |
Interface Type | SPI | |
Analog Supply Voltage | 2.35 V to 3.6 V | V |
Digital Supply Voltage | 2.35 V to 3.6 V | V |
Signal to Noise Ratio (SNR) | 72.6 dB | dB |
Minimum Operating Temperature | -40°C | °C |
Maximum Operating Temperature | +125°C | °C |
Package/Case | TQFN-28 | |
Reference Type | External | |
Reference Voltage Range | 1 V to VDD | V |
Key Features
- Scan modes, internal averaging, and internal clock for flexible operation.
- 16-entry First-In-First-Out (FIFO) for efficient data handling.
- User-defined channel sequence (SampleSet) with a maximum length of 256.
- Analog multiplexer with true differential track/hold.
- Flexible input configuration: 16-/8-/4-channel single-ended, 8-/4-/2-channel fully differential pairs, and 15-/8-/4-channel pseudo-differential relative to a common input.
- Two software-selectable bipolar input ranges.
- High accuracy: ±1 LSB INL, ±1 LSB DNL, no missing codes over temperature range.
- 70 dB SINAD guaranteed at 250 kHz input frequency.
- Low power consumption: 4.2 mW at 500 kS/s with 3 V supplies, 2 µA full-shutdown current.
- External differential reference (1 V to VDD).
- 8 MHz, 3-wire SPI-/QSPI-/MICROWIRE-/DSP-compatible serial interface.
- Wide -40°C to +125°C operation range.
- Space-saving, 28-pin, 5mm x 5mm TQFN package.
Applications
The MAX11137ATI+T is ideal for various applications requiring multiple analog inputs, such as industrial automation, medical devices, data acquisition systems, and portable electronics. Its low power consumption and high accuracy make it particularly suitable for battery-powered devices and systems where energy efficiency is crucial.
